**Turnstile Upgrade — Larkfield Plaza Lobby**

New optical turnstiles go live Monday. Old swipe lanes are decommissioned; remove signage by Friday. Badges need re-encoding at the facilities desk — allow two minutes per person, no appointment. Tailgating now triggers an audible alarm; log repeat offenders. The accessible lane operates on the same system. During the cutover window, staff the bypass gate using the code below.

staff pass of yafof-baweg = bdg-OLNEG-5

For those new to the team: ReminderSpark sends SMS and email reminders to patients of Larkfield Clinic 48 hours before their appointments. We've adjusted the batching window from 15 to 5 minutes to reduce load spikes on the messaging queue. Please review the retry logic carefully — failed sends now requeue at most twice before being logged for manual follow-up. This change touches patient-facing behavior, so it cannot ship without explicit approval. Sign-off for this ticket rests with the name below.

account owner for fajep-yagef: Kasix Eliiel

## Deploying the Gatewick Proctor Queue

Deploys are pretty painless: push to main, wait for the pipeline, then watch the queue drain dashboard for five minutes. If candidates pile up mid-exam, roll back first and ask questions later — the queue replays safely. Everything the workers care about lives in one config block, shown here for reference.

settings of bafof-yagef:
JOROX_PIN=8740
JOROX_TENANT=pelox
JOROX_METRICS_HOST=metrics.jorox.qorvelworks.internal
JOROX_SEAL=seal_c78f63c1
JOROX_STANDBY_TEAM=norax